A towel might be positioned on the cleaner head if there is concern that bed insects might be blown away by the heavy steam. Move the steamer gradually when bed pests are concealing in cracks or behind material. Apply heavy steam straight under the furniture to kill bed insects that was up to the floor after treating the furniture.
Take care - vapor may damage finished furniture surfaces and some materials such as microfiber. When lots of bed bugs are present, a vacuum cleaner machine can be used to promptly remove live and dead bed bugs and their shed skins. Location a knee-high equipping over the end of the vacuum cleaner tube and secure it with an elastic band prior to positioning the attachment, to catch the insects and stop them from infesting the vacuum (Number 6).
When you end up vacuuming, remove the stocking and dispose of in a secured plastic bag. It needs to be kept in mind that bed pest eggs or live bed pest nymphs and adults concealing see here in fractures may not have the ability to be removed by vacuuming. A heavily plagued couch with numerous bed insect hiding locations is tough to deal with and examine (Figure 7). Think about discarding significantly plagued furniture that is in disrepair or no more wanted. If possible, replace wooden bed structures with metal bed structures in places where bed bug troubles are extreme.
DEET dealt with textile is repellent to bed bugs (Wang et al. 2013). Business insect repellents containing DEET for warding off ticks and attacking insects are additionally practical for stopping bed insects when applied to outer surface of clothing (Figure 8). If the repellent item does not list bed bugs on the label, you ought to first get in touch with your state pesticide regulatory firm to see if these repellents are permitted to be used for security versus bed insects.

North Arizona State University researchers checked out four parasite repellers (Yturralde and Hofstetter 2012). None of the repellers influenced bed insect behavior. Ultrasonic parasite repellents have not been revealed to be helpful for controlling bed bugs. Some consumers put anti-static sheet on furniture in an attempt to ward off bed insects (Number 10).

Unfortunately, the majority of them are inefficient (Singh et al. 2014). Of 11 evaluated products examined, just two (EcoRaider and Bed Insect Patrol) accomplished more than 90% bed insect death when directly splashed on bed insect nymphs under lab problems. One product (EcoRaider) caused 87% egg death when directly sprayed to eggs.

Foggers are commonly used for regulating indoor bugs. A research by Ohio State College shows foggers are entirely ineffective against bed pests (Jones and Bryant 2012).

Pyrethroids are a course of pesticides frequently made use of for interior pest control. Current studies show the majority of the area bed bug populations are immune to pyrethroids. The effectiveness of these items when used as the from this source sole method of control is usually extremely reduced as a result of prevalence of bed insect pesticide resistance.
After treatment, bed pest numbers end up being tiny and a lot more hard to find. To prevent early discontinuation of therapy, use a mix of visual assessment and bed bug keeps track of to detect bed pests and validate they are without a doubt gotten rid of. Quit therapy only when you can not find bed bugs after using those techniques for a month.
